Roofing inspection services involve a thorough evaluation of a property's roof to assess its current condition and identify potential issues. These inspections typically cover all types of roofing projects, including residential homes, multi-family buildings, and commercial properties. Property owners often request inspections after severe weather events, when planning for maintenance or repairs, or prior to purchasing or selling a property. The goal is to detect signs of damage, wear, or aging that could lead to leaks, structural problems, or costly repairs in the future.
Before requesting a roofing inspection, property owners generally want to understand what areas will be examined and what findings might mean for their property’s safety and longevity. They may also seek information on visible signs of damage, such as missing shingles, sagging areas, or water stains, as well as hidden issues that can only be identified through a detailed inspection. Clear communication about the scope of the inspection and the potential next steps can help homeowners make informed decisions about maintenance, repairs, or replacements.

Roofing Inspection Service Questions
What is a roofing inspection? A roofing inspection involves evaluating the condition of a roof to identify any damage, wear, or potential issues that may need attention.
When should a roof be inspected? Roofs should be inspected after severe weather, if there are visible damages, or as part of regular maintenance to ensure longevity.
What does a roofing inspection include? The process typically includes checking for missing or damaged shingles, leaks, structural issues, and the overall integrity of the roofing system.
Why are roofing inspections important? Regular inspections help detect problems early, preventing costly repairs and extending the roof's lifespan.
